OpenLedger and Chainbase Unite to Power Trustless AI in Web3

Building Transparent Foundations for Decentralized AI

OpenLedger, a platform focused on deploying artificial intelligence models across decentralized networks, has announced a strategic partnership with Chainbase, an omnichain data ecosystem designed for AI applications. The collaboration is intended to support the development of transparent, trustless, and data-first AI systems within Web3 environments. By aligning their respective technologies, the two platforms aim to address long-standing concerns around data provenance, accountability, and auditability in autonomous AI operations.

OpenLedger is known for introducing Proof of Attribution, a mechanism designed to clarify the origin and lifecycle of intelligence used by AI agents. Chainbase, meanwhile, operates as an advanced omnichain data infrastructure that aggregates and standardizes blockchain data for AI use cases. Through this partnership, both organizations seek to establish a more reliable foundation for AI systems that operate without centralized control.

Addressing the Trust Gap in AI Agents

According to OpenLedger, one of the major challenges facing AI agents today is a lack of trust stemming from unclear data histories and opaque decision-making processes. AI systems typically ingest large volumes of data, perform transformations or reasoning, and then execute actions. However, in many existing frameworks, the lineage of that data is not fully transparent, inputs are not always cryptographically verifiable, and outcomes cannot be audited from start to finish.

These limitations have contributed to skepticism around AI-generated outputs, particularly in decentralized environments where trust minimization is a core principle. OpenLedger indicated that resolving these issues requires a system capable of tracking intelligence from its source through every stage of processing and execution.

Proof of Attribution as a Verifiable Record

OpenLedger’s Proof of Attribution mechanism is designed to respond directly to these concerns. The system anchors AI operations to structured, high-quality, and verifiable on-chain data. By doing so, it maintains a comprehensive record of how intelligence flows across the AI lifecycle.

The platform explained that Proof of Attribution enables clear visibility into which datasets were accessed, how information was transformed or reasoned over, which model generated a specific output, and what actions followed. This level of traceability allows AI behavior to be reviewed and verified, supporting stronger accountability and reducing uncertainty for users and developers alike.

Chainbase’s Role in Omnichain Data Integrity

Chainbase contributes to the partnership by providing an omnichain data ecosystem tailored for AI. Its infrastructure aggregates data across multiple blockchains, normalizes it, and makes it accessible for AI-driven applications. By integrating with OpenLedger’s attribution framework, Chainbase helps ensure that the underlying data feeding AI systems remains consistent, verifiable, and transparent across networks.

This combination is positioned to strengthen the reliability of decentralized AI by aligning data integrity with clear attribution. Together, the platforms aim to create an environment where AI agents can operate using trusted inputs while producing outputs that can be independently validated.

Toward Trustless AI Infrastructure in Web3

The alliance between OpenLedger and Chainbase extends beyond technical integration. It effectively establishes a structured record of AI behavior that maps how decisions are formed and executed. Each step in the process is captured within a transparent and verifiable framework, reducing ambiguity and reinforcing trust in autonomous systems.

This approach is seen as a foundational step toward verifiable and autonomous AI systems in Web3. By making AI execution transparent rather than opaque, the partnership positions AI agents as accountable participants within decentralized ecosystems rather than black-box tools.

Enabling Autonomous AI Without Centralized Oversight

Both OpenLedger and Chainbase have emphasized a shared vision of AI systems that can function independently without relying on centralized authorities. The partnership is intended to support AI agents that can prove their actions, data usage, and decision-making processes through cryptographic verification and on-chain records.

As decentralized applications increasingly incorporate AI-driven logic, the need for trustless and auditable systems continues to grow. Through this collaboration, OpenLedger and Chainbase aim to set a new standard for how AI infrastructure is built in Web3, enabling systems that are transparent by design and capable of earning trust through verifiable data and actions.
